List: District 3 Class 4A championship games

Forty-three different school have won District 3 football championships.

Neither Twin Valley nor Susquehanna Township are part of that list — yet. One will be added Friday when those teams meet for the Class 4A championship.

There have been 40 previous Class 4A championship games, starting in 1985, when the PIAA expanded from three to four classifications. (The PIAA added 5A and 6A in 2015.)

Cumberland Valley has won the most 4A titles, with 11. Wilson and Bishop McDevitt have each won six.

The only other Berks team to win a 4A title is Berks Catholic, which won in 2016 and 2017.

Of the 40 previous Class 4A Tournaments, the No. 1 seed has won 21 times.

The longest 4A championship game was played between Cumberland Valley and Central Dauphin in 2015; it spilled over into seven overtimes.

Here’s the list of championship games:



2024: Lampeter Strasburg 30, Wyomissing 27 (OT)
2023: Bishop McDevitt 23, Manheim Central 17
2022: Bishop McDevitt 40, Manheim Central 0
2021: Bishop McDevitt 7, Lampeter Strasburg 0
2020: Lampeter Strasburg 20, Elco 3
2019: Lampeter Strasburg 35, Berks Catholic 21
2018: Bishop McDevitt 41, Berks Catholic 31
2017: Berks Catholic 45, Bishop McDevitt 24
2016: Berks Catholic 37, Shippensburg 13
2015: Cumberland Valley 62, Central Dauphin 61 (7 OT)
2014: Wilson 21, Central Dauphin 10
2013: Lower Dauphin 24, Cumberland Valley 21
2012: Wilson 39, Harrisburg 14
2011: Central Dauphin 24, Wilson 21
2010: Cumberland Valley 35, Red Lion 7
2009: Cumberland Valley 34, Bishop McDevitt 27 (2 OT)
2008: Wilson 35, Cumberland Valley 7
2007: Harrisburg 49, Governor Mifflin 14
2006: State College 21, Governor Mifflin 0
2005: Bishop McDevitt 20, State College 17
2004: Bishop McDevitt 48, Carlisle 28
2003: Cumberland Valley 32, Reading 14
2002: Central Dauphin 35, Wilson 33
2001: Cumberland Valley 28, J.P. McCaskey 18
2000: Cumberland Valley 49, South Western 14
1999: Wilson 47, Cumberland Valley 0
1998: Cumberland Valley 14, Central Dauphin 10
1997: Central Dauphin 52, Cedar Crest 31
1996: Cedar Cliff 38, Wilson 13
1995: Lower Dauphin 36, Cedar Crest 19
1994: Cumberland Valley 21, Gettysburg 13
1993: Cumberland Valley 19, Chambersburg 14
1992: Cumberland Valley 10, Harrisburg 7
1991: Cumberland Valley 14, J.P. McCaskey 6
1990: Wilson 34, Cumberland Valley 32
1989: Wilson 17, Cedar Cliff 7
1988: Cedar Cliff 22, McCaskey 12
1987: Cedar Cliff 2, Cumberland Valley 0
1986: Mechanicsburg 21, Carlisle 20
1985: Carlisle 27, Cumberland Valley 3
